When my sas program finishes running, i want to create a new column in the output and find out if the last digit in my transitx column is a 7 or 8. There is a gap or white border appearing between columns on the rows and the summary border that i cannot figure out how to get rid of, despite playing with various borderwidth and borderspacing options. Generally, when i see pdf inserting extra space, it happens because i am trying to overcontrol the widths of the columns so what happens if you take out either the outputwidth100% or the hardcoded cellwidth of 1in for the n statistic. The ods layout gridded statement must be used with the ods layout end statement. Customizing text in column headings sas help center. Sas load programs are used to load the ascii or csv data files into sas. For example, to obtain the contents of the sas data set htwt from the procedure input library, use the. Summing numeric variables with multiple by variables tree level 4. The sas, which is part of its clarity project, supersedes sas no. Sometimes data files contain information that is superfluous to a particular analysis, in which case we might want to change the data file to contain only variables of interest.
Proc sql writes the columns that you create as if they were columns from the table. Gridded layout is supported for html and printer destinations pdf, ps, and pcl. Sas data step compile, execution, and the program data vector. Creating a column for each value of a variable base sas. Examples include using the column option to divide the output into multiple columns on a page, and the text option to insert raw text and formatting. The load programs are provided in sas format and there is one sas load program for each data file.
Issue an ods region statement to define the first region 1st column. Explanatory memorandum statement on auditing standards no. With sas data preparation running on sas viya, you can quickly prepare data for analytics in a selfservice, pointandclick environment that enables you to get the business insights you need on your own to make decisions confidently. Column attributes are used to customize the attributes of a column and must be specified within a define column statement block. Hcup central distributor sas load programs nationwide. Auditing standards board issues statement on auditing. Key concepts about differences between sudaan and sas survey procedures logistic regression output. Hello, i am trying to use proc report and ods pdf to generate a stylized report with alternate row highlighting. Linking sas table columns and scl variables the next step in accessing the data is to link the sas table columns in the tdv with the scl window variables and nonwindow variables in the sdv. Sas filespecification can take one of the following forms.
The ods pdf statement is part of the ods printer family of statements. The steps below assume that you are already familiar with the sas code used to append nhanes datasets. You can specify multiple column attributes together or separately. Jun 26, 2012 hes a longtime sas user and frequent presenter at sas conferences. An adobe portable document format pdf file is an ideal way to create and share. Nowd option runs the proc report without the report window. Output delivery system to turn it into a web page, pdf file, word document. The function that you use depends on whether the scl variables and sas table columns have the same name and type. The following links provide sas load programs for the nationwide emergency department sample neds. Data sas filespecification specifies an entire library or a specific sas data set within a library. In each iteration of the loop, a copy of table 3 is created and the appropriate values for var1 and var2 are determined based on their position in. Create a new column in sas output solutions experts exchange. The wilcoxon rankrum test wilcoxon mannwhiney utest, or wmw test a common experiment design is to have a test and control conditions.
Assign serial numbers to observations in a data set in sas. By default, the fetch function starts with the first row in the sas table and reads the next row from the sas table each time it executes. For example, you can specify the following column attributes together. How can i generate pdf and html files for my sas output. In addition to selecting columns that are stored in a table, you can create new columns that exist for the duration of the query. Click the column name in the available items list, and then click. Classdatasasdataset specifies a data set that contains the combinations of values of the class variables that must be present in the output. Cleaning dirty data michigan sas users group home page. When you will use nowd option in report answer srinu. In the program below, the loop macro contains a loop that runs three times, once for each of the three stimuli. Each output data set summarizes and reports data for one of the types that are specified in the types statement. The default for libref is the libref of the procedure input library.
A partial view of each output data set is shown below. This section lists all the attributes that you can use in a column template. This variable is automatically created when a sas data set is built and is incremented by 1 for each iteration of the data step. Read the pdf file into sas and then extract each relevant text and attribute as a string. The values of rc are dependent on the attributename. The next step in accessing the data is to link the sas table columns in the tdv with the scl window variables and nonwindow variables in the sdv. My guess is that those 2 width specifications are somehow colliding and pdf doesnt know how to draw the table. You can use the nods option to suppress the descriptor portions in the report. Working with sas libraries and sas data sets sas programming 1. The final semicolon indicates that there is no more data to be read. If they want to print, pdf file always stay on small size, how to solve this issue, how to set uo pdf default size as the normall readable size. A data step is a group of sas language statements that begin with a data statement and contains other programming statements that manipulate existing sas data sets or create sas data sets from raw data files.
Hi, ive searched for an answer to this, but have come up blank. How to mimic the n function for character variables using. Oct, 2010 i regret that i cannot offer personal assistance. Overall, responders to the exposure draft were supportive of the asbs proposal to update sas no.
Wilcoxon rank sum procedure demonstrated with an example. This tip sheet places frequently used information in one place, on one sheet of paper, so you. Pdf file style keyword columns, modifying page setup e. A cumulative zip file containing the sas load programs for every year for each database type is also provided below. The sas file structure is similar to a spreadsheet. Clinical data interchange standards consortium standards developing organization sdo global, open, multidisciplinary, vendorneutral, nonprofit. I checked with dictionary table present in sas like vtable or vslib but i couldnt find all the library or. Essentials 2 by default, a proc contents report includes the descriptor portion of each data set in the sas library. You can add text to the output by including a string expression, or literal. Selecting variables for a report ordering the rows in a report using aliases to obtain multiple statistics for the same variable consolidating multiple observations into one row of a report creating a column for each value of a variable displaying multiple statistics for one variable storing and reusing a report definition condensing a report into multiple panels writing a customized summary. When contents of the same group variables carry to the following page, the group variables do not display. Sas writes in traditional output file like in html body,rtf or pdf files.
Im trying to create productionquality tables using proc report in an ods pdf output where i can group columns together having borders between certain columns, but not other columns. Ability to continue as a going concern, to supersede sas no. The aicpas auditing standards board asb issued statement on auditing standards sas no. It is also supported for the ods destination for powerpoint. Optional on the transpose columns tab, specify the columns that contain the data with which you want to populate the output table. For up to n pdf file that includes bookmarks for tables within the output. The impact of statements on auditing standards sas 104 111. The sas documentation describes the data step as follows. Nov 16, 20 when my sas program finishes running, i want to create a new column in the output and find out if the last digit in my transitx column is a 7 or 8. Function equivalent to scan function in sas do you want on designer side or reporting side, as bot is possible using string functions.
Zdeb contacted me after he read the may sas tech report to say that he had an idea for reducing the number of steps in one of the sas samples in the tips. Any combinations of values of the class variables that occur in the classdata data set but not in the input data set appear in the output and have a frequency of zero. The column headings of the columns that are transposed will be deleted. Selecting variables for a report ordering the rows in a report using aliases to obtain multiple statistics for the same variable consolidating multiple observations into one row of a report creating a column for each value of a variable displaying multiple statistics for one variable storing and reusing a report definition condensing a report into multiple panels writing a. How do i hide proc report column borders in ods pdf. Description of bugs occurring in pdf and rtf output for sas versions 8. I checked with dictionary table present in sas like vtable or vslib but i couldnt find all the library or tables except some sas predefined metad.
Sas load programs are provided by year, by database type. Creating a column for each value of a variable base sasr. For up to n sas macros are very adept at solving this type of problem, where looping is required. The data matrix contain rows of observations and columns of variables.
Sas load programs may be used to convert the csv data files into sas format. Data values are stored as variables, which are like fields or columns on a spreadsheet. Files are provided in sas format and there is one sas load program for each data file. The viewer provides a quick and convenient way to view sas datasets, catalogs, transports, jmp files, html files, and all textbased files without invoking sas, or even having sas installed on your computer. When you will use nowd option in report answer suri. As a result of its clarity project, the auditing standards board asb has issued statement on auditing standards sas no. Text size specifies the number of characters to use in the text variable of the. Hes a longtime sas user and frequent presenter at sas conferences.
If an application has some scl variables that match sas table columns and others that. In my new column, i want to display sk if its an 8 and mb if its a 7. You can drag columns in a module view to change the order of columns. Below, we run a regression model separately for each of the four race categories in our data. The n function counts nonnull and nonmissing values, whereas the nmiss function counts missing values. Im using the column and header styles to do adjust the appearances. The sas universal viewer is a freely distributed application for viewing and printing files that were created by sas. This statement opens, manages, or closes the pdf destination, which produces pdf output, a form of output that is read by adobe acrobat and other applications.
To be a good sas programmer it is essential that you understand the intricacies of the data step because some tasks related to data manipulation and. Key concepts about differences between sudaan and sas survey. Opportunities and challenges for adopting cdisc standards. The attrn function returns information about a numeric attribute of an open sas data set. Tip sheet ods pdf tip sheet ods pdf tip sheet sas support. Overcome programming problems with sas automatic variable n. I did try this with and without page breaks startpagenow and it did not work either. The wilcoxon ranksum test wmw test analyzing the data with wmw test. Before the proc reg, we first sort the data by race and then open a. The aicpas auditing standards board issued statement on auditing standards sas no.
836 1338 323 1048 179 1182 791 686 750 1040 128 829 1451 865 953 1126 361 9 94 797 583 1030 222 1251 216 1415 1008 683 423 685 51 274 932 184 163 436 1144 861 966 521 14 47 1378 1022 1302 1476